Small is beautiful : spectroscopic proof or any other indication for the existence of formyl azide (HC(O)N 3 ) has until now been lacking. Although it liberates dinitrogen much more rapidly than homologous acyl azides, it has been prepared for the first time by four different methods (see scheme).
